ResumoThe aim of this paper is to explain to what extent the category of Grothendieck toposes can be described in terms of groupoids (in the category of locales).In the first section, I describe how every groupoid G gives rise to a topos BG, and in section 2, I discuss some of the functorial properties of this constrution G ~ BG.After having introduced two completeness properties of groupoids, we will see that toposes can be obtained by localizing groupoids ( §4) or by considering geometric morphisms as obtained by tensoring with something analogous to a bimodule ( §5).In section 6 I briefly discuss the fundamental group of a topos.This paper provides a summary of my earlier papers [M2], [M3], [M4].Since the proofs given there are often long and technical, and involve extensive use of change-of-base methods, I believe it is worthwhile to present these results all together in a more directly accessible way, and save the reader from being distracted by perhaps less digestible technicalities.
